Transaction 61f7201d58a4fe26873f7ea319e6c8f59f663d98f8b5e2389a170395568a0af1

block
cddca8addeba89fde4ce1ec6400e43c0e5ecfd4fccd0dad1e3ba808b1a3de709

1 Input

23 Outputs